Top Shopping Games on Android in Georgia: Q3 2025 Performance
Explore the performance trends of the top shopping games on Android in Georgia during Q3 2025, featuring downloads and revenue insights.
During the third quarter of 2025, the top shopping games on Android in Georgia showcased varied performance across downloads and revenue metrics. Here’s a closer look at the trends for these leading apps, based on data from Sensor Tower.
Go Convenience store Ready! saw a significant rise in weekly downloads, beginning with 865 in mid-July and peaking at approximately 3.3K by the end of September. Despite the strong download performance, there was no recorded revenue for this period.
My Supermarket Simulator 3D® experienced a decline in weekly downloads, starting from 2.3K at the beginning of the quarter and dropping to 836 by late September, before a slight recovery to 1.3K. Its weekly revenue diminished gradually, from $27 at the start to $4 by early September, eventually ceasing by mid-month.
Goods Puzzle: Sort Challenge™ maintained a relatively steady download rate, with a notable increase from 781 in early July to 1.6K by the end of September. Revenue fluctuated, reaching highs of $85 in mid-August and closing the quarter at $53.
Hypermarket 3D: Store Cashier had a decreasing trend in weekly downloads, starting from over 1K and hitting a low of 208 in mid-September, with a slight rebound to 446 by the end of the quarter. The app did not generate any revenue during this period.
Lastly, Goods Puzzle: 3D Sorting Games displayed a remarkable surge in downloads, especially towards the end of the quarter, with numbers jumping from 65 in early August to over 1.3K by September. Revenue, however, remained minimal, peaking at $7 in mid-September.
